Embrace Scar Therapy is a innovative treatment that utilizes tension-relief technology to improve the appearance of scars. This non-invasive approach helps to minimize the formation of raised, discolored, or uneven scarring by managing the tension and forces that can lead to abnormal scar development.
The level and duration of pain associated with Embrace Scar Therapy can vary depending on the individual's skin type, the location and severity of the scar, and the specific treatment plan prescribed by the cosmetic surgeon. In general, patients can expect to experience some mild discomfort during the initial application of the Embrace device, but this typically subsides within a few minutes.
During the treatment process, patients may feel a gentle pulling or tugging sensation as the Embrace device is applied to the scar area. This sensation is a result of the tension-relief mechanism that helps to alter the scar's formation. While this may be slightly uncomfortable, most patients report that the discomfort is minimal and well-tolerated.
In the days following the initial Embrace Scar Therapy application, patients may experience some mild swelling, redness, and tenderness in the treated area. This is a normal response as the body adjusts to the device and the scar-modifying process begins. This post-treatment discomfort is usually short-lived, with most patients reporting a significant reduction in pain and sensitivity within 24-48 hours.
It's important to note that the duration and intensity of pain can also be influenced by the size and location of the scar. Scars on more sensitive areas, such as the face or joints, may be more prone to discomfort during the Embrace Scar Therapy process. However, the cosmetic surgeon can adjust the treatment plan and provide guidance on pain management strategies to ensure a comfortable and effective experience for the patient.
Overall, the pain associated with Embrace Scar Therapy is generally mild and well-tolerated, with the majority of patients experiencing only temporary discomfort during the initial application and in the immediate aftermath of the treatment.
